I have not had to much time to play with it. Quality is very good. The blade closes dead center, opens and closes smoothly. The weld line between the two steels is back about a 1/4 inch from the blade bevels and wanders a little. I was quite surprised that it is this far back. I thought the lamination of zdp189 would be thinner but this good. Knife is very sharp out of the box..even for Spyderco which is its norm.. this one is sharp. Eventually I will thin the bevels to twenty degrees when it gets dull.

I will play with it this weekend and cut some stuff besides arm hair.
